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of sealing and vibration reduction technology for mining electric vehicles, and in particular to a sealing, vibration reduction and noise reduction structure for mining electric vehicles. Background Technology

[0002] Sealed shock absorbers for mining electric vehicles are a type of sealed shock absorber used in mining transport vehicles.

[0003] The sealed shock absorbers of mining electric vehicles play a role in cushioning the vehicle's structural sinking when transporting materials underground. Due to the complex underground environment, when the vehicle is fully loaded and passes through a pit, the shock absorbers reach their maximum descent limit. At this time, the shock absorbers will generate huge noise due to the internal impact, and the noise will be transmitted to the cab. Due to long-term driving, the noise will have a certain impact on the driver's hearing. The existing noise reduction methods use cab sound insulation to reduce the transmission of noise, but they cannot reduce noise at the source. Therefore, it will affect the driver's judgment of other sounds, which can easily lead to dangerous situations while driving.

[0025] When the sealing damper 1 moves downward under the pressure from above, the power rod 2 moves downward under the drive of the sealing damper 1. At the same time, the support rod 4 begins to rotate under the support of the rotating shaft 3, and also begins to rotate under the support of the sliding shaft 6. Due to the downward movement of the power rod 2, the support rod 4 begins to move downward. When the support rod 4 begins to move downward, the sliding shaft 6 follows the movement of the support rod 4 and begins to move downward. When the sliding shaft 6 begins to move downward, it pulls the sound insulation component 7. At this time, the sound insulation component 7 is pulled and begins to rotate towards the center point of the sealing damper 1. When the sealing damper 1 reaches its maximum sinking point, the sound insulation component 7 is closed. At the same time, the upper half of the power rod 2 is located outside the sound insulation component 7, and the lower half of the power rod 2 and the support rod 4 are located inside the sound insulation component 7. When the sealing damper 1 begins to move upward, the power rod 2 begins to move upward. Pulling the support rod 4 upwards causes the end of the support rod 4 near the power rod 2 and the power shaft 3 to begin rotating and moving upwards. Simultaneously, the other end of the support rod 4 and the sliding shaft 6 begin rotating. As one end of the support rod 4 moves upwards, the support rod 4 begins to unfold to both sides. At this time, the sliding shaft 6, pushed by the support rod 4, begins to drive the sound insulation component 7 to rotate. The sound insulation component 7 then rotates away from the center point of the sealing and vibration damping 1. When the sealing and vibration damping 1 returns to its initial state, the sound insulation component 7 also returns to its initial state. At this point, the noise reduction work for the impact noise of the sealing and vibration damping is completed. By setting the sound insulation component 7, it can isolate noise during the impact of the sealing and vibration damping 1, achieving a noise reduction effect and improving the noise reduction effect of the sealing and vibration damping. By setting the support rod 4, the sound insulation component 7 can perform closing and unfolding actions, isolating noise and achieving a noise reduction effect, thereby improving the noise reduction effect of the sealing and vibration damping.

Figure 1 - Figure 5 As shown, the sound insulation component 7 has a vibration isolation layer 701 inside, a sound insulation layer 702 on one side of the vibration isolation layer 701, a sound absorption layer 703 on one side of the sound insulation layer 702, and a protective layer 704 on one side of the sound absorption layer 703.

[0034] When the loud impact noise of the sealed vibration damper 1 is transmitted through vibration, the vibration damping layer 701 on the sound insulation component 7, which is attached to its surface, reduces the vibration. The weakened noise continues to be transmitted into the sound insulation component 7. When the noise passes through the vibration damping layer 701 and reaches the sound insulation layer 702, the thick material of the sound insulation layer 702 isolates the noise, weakening it again. The noise then passes through the sound insulation layer 702 and enters the sound absorption layer 703. The sound absorption layer 703 contains sound-absorbing material, and the noise is absorbed by the sound absorption layer 703. At the same time, the protective layer 704 isolates external debris to prevent it from scratching the sound insulation component 7. By using the vibration damping layer 701, the sound insulation layer 702, and the sound absorption layer 703 in combination, the noise transmission is reduced, and the noise is isolated and absorbed, thereby further improving the noise reduction effect of the sealed vibration damper 1.
